Light Blocking Layer for Display Edge Protection
Find Innovative SolutionsGenerate Solutions
Solution Overview
Problem
Display devices, particularly OLED devices, face exposure issues of internal layers due to oblique external light transmission, leading to exposure of dummy emission layers and other components at the edges of the window, compromising protection and functionality.
Innovation Solution
A display device design incorporating a substrate with distinct regions, where a light blocking layer is applied to the side surfaces of the polarizer, touch panel, and window, as well as the top surface of the dummy emission layer on the outer periphery region, to prevent external light from exposing internal components. This design includes a manufacturing method involving the formation of an emission layer, polarizer, touch panel, and window, followed by the application of a light blocking layer to cover these areas.

A display device including: a substrate configured to include a first region and a second region formed at an outer periphery of the first region; an emission layer disposed on the first region and the second region of the substrate; a polarizer disposed on the emission layer; a touch panel disposed on the polarizer; a window disposed on the touch panel; and a light blocking layer covering side surfaces of the polarizer and the touch panel and a top surface of the emission layer disposed on the second region of the substrate. The polarizer and the touch panel cover the first region of the substrate and expose the second region of the substrate.
